Review summary

I chose this cruise for it's low price which was a mistake. They charge for room service if you want hot food. The buffet was terrible! I have never spit out so much food in my life! The sit down restaurants were very snooty. Hostesses acted like you were bothering them. Carnival did not post anywhere that there were 2 formal nights yet they refused service to everyone dressed casually. The entire staff was poorly trained. I was cut off over 50 times by staff who expected you to get out of their way, it should be the other way around. The food was terrible to mediocre everywhere except Guys burgers which was great,

luggage was left in the hallway not placed in the room. No one even knocked, I found it there in the morning!

For 7 days no one on picked up the phone NO SERVICE for anything. My neighbor was smoking on the balcony all the time. Security was not listed on the phone, if it was, they too probably would not answer. Never saw a security guard anywhere.

The fire drill was not proper as they did not require you to bring your life jacket. I found them very hard to get on as I am a large person.

People were complaining at the spa for being charged when they only came in for the free consultations offered. I am monitoring my card and will protest if they try that with me.

The comedians were good but all other entertainment was terrible.

Movies being played broke down often

My first excursion was canceled and they did not tell me. I only found out after searching for 30 minutes for someone who knew anything. Gave us no time to book another.

their private island stop - terrible food. over crowded, and no shopping worth your time.

I last sailed with Princess. Their Alaskan was incredible! Great staff (porter gave me his cell and ALWAYS answered if we needed anything, Room service was free and great food. Most food was good. None of the above problems were experienced with Princess. Will use them for the next cruise.
